ScummVM API documentation
Bagel::MFC::CMenu Class Reference
Inheritance diagram for Bagel::MFC::CMenu:
Bagel::MFC::CObject

Public Member Functions

bool CreateMenu ()
 
bool CreatePopupMenu ()
 
bool LoadMenu (const char *lpszResourceName)
 
bool LoadMenu (unsigned int nIDResource)
 
bool LoadMenuIndirect (const void *lpMenuTemplate)
 
bool DestroyMenu ()
 
unsigned int CheckMenuItem (unsigned int nIDCheckItem, unsigned int nCheck)
 
- Public Member Functions inherited from Bagel::MFC::CObject
 CObject (const CObject &)=default
 
CObjectoperator= (const CObject &)=default
 
virtual const CRuntimeClassGetRuntimeClass () const
 
virtual void AssertValid () const
 
virtual void Dump (CDumpContext &dc) const
 
bool IsKindOf (const CRuntimeClass *pClass) const
 

Static Public Member Functions

static CMenuFromHandle (HMENU hMenu)
 

Additional Inherited Members

- Static Public Attributes inherited from Bagel::MFC::CObject
static const CRuntimeClass classCObject
 

The documentation for this class was generated from the following file: